n early 2011, Young America’s Foundation launched the Reagan 100 Lecture Series as part of our year-long celebration of the 100th anniversary of Ronald Reagan’s birth. This series, made possible through the generous support of the Wendy P. McCaw Foundation, features some of the Foundation’s most popular speakers including Ben Stein, Michelle Malkin, Ann Coulter, Michael Reagan, Dinesh D’Souza, Paul Kengor, Peter Schweizer, Bay Buchanan, Kate Obenshain, Jonah Goldberg, David Limbaugh, and Stephen Moore. These speakers bring Reagan’s ideas to life for the next generation to ensure they understand the importance of

freedom. President Reagan recognized the great need for current leaders to inspire and reach young audiences with the ideas that make our nation great. As he stated in 1974, “We are the showcase of the future. And it is within our power to mold that future, this year and for decades to come. It can be as grand or great as we make it. No crisis is beyond the capacity of our people to solve, no challenge too great.” Each Reagan 100 lecture is planned by student activists and leaders who are eager to introduce their peers to Ronald Reagan’s ideas and lasting accomplishments.
